What Does "i think it might be the maid" Mean?

Learn what "i think it might be the maid" means, when people say it, and how to use it naturally in English.

Intermediate
Neutral
Soft
Express Doubt

I think it might be the maid.

It means the speaker thinks the maid could be the person involved or responsible.

From Hidden Agenda, Episode 42

When do people say this?

Scene Context

Someone is guessing that the maid may be responsible.

Usage Scenario

Use this when making a cautious guess about who did something. It sounds natural, but it can be inappropriate if it sounds like an accusation without proof.

Better ways to say it

1
Maybe it's the maid.
2
I think the maid might be involved.
3
It could be the maid.
